titleOfInvention Liquid fertilizer and application method thereof
abstract The invention provides a liquid fertilizer and a using method thereof, belonging to the technical field of resource recycling and fertilizer preparation. The liquid fertilizer provided by the invention takes the bamboo willow wet carbonization wastewater as a main component, and the liquid fertilizer has the function of inhibiting bacteria because the bamboo willow wet carbonization wastewater contains polyphenol substances; mineral elements contained in the bamboo willow wet carbonization wastewater ensure that the liquid fertilizer has sufficient trace elements; in addition, the content of iron ore elements in the liquid fertilizer is further increased by adding the sugar alcohol chelated iron; the addition of humic acid increases the fertilizer efficiency of the liquid fertilizer; the organic silicon additive can enhance the permeability of the liquid fertilizer and improve the fertilizer efficiency of the liquid fertilizer. The data of the examples show that: the liquid fertilizer provided by the invention has obvious effect of improving the yield of rape and amaranth.
